Common Ramset Gate Motor Repair Problems in Westchester

πŸ”§ Overheating and Burning Smell

In Westchester's warm climate, a Ramset motor consistently running hot or emitting a burning odor often signals a failing capacitor, shorted windings, or excessive internal friction. This critical issue, if neglected, can quickly lead to irreversible motor damage.

πŸ”§ Loud Grinding or Whining Noises

Odd sounds emanating from your gate motor unit typically indicate worn bearings, inadequate lubrication within the gearbox, or debris obstructing internal mechanisms. These problems hinder smooth gate operation and place undue stress on the motor, particularly in high-use areas like Fontainebleau.

πŸ”§ Motor Stalling or Jerky Operation

If your Ramset motor struggles to operate the gate, stalls mid-cycle, or moves erratically, it could be suffering from low torque due to internal electrical faults, worn carbon brushes, or a compromised motor control board, issues that can be exacerbated by humidity.

πŸ”§ Complete Motor Failure (No Movement/Humming)

When the gate receives power but the motor remains unresponsive, or merely produces a humming sound without movement, it frequently points to a seized motor, a fractured drive shaft, or a total electrical breakdown within the motor windings, common concerns in older systems.

πŸ”§ Water Intrusion and Corrosion

Given Westchester's persistent humidity and frequent downpours, water penetration into the motor casing is a significant threat. This leads to severe corrosion of electrical terminals and internal components, resulting in intermittent operation, hazardous electrical shorts, or complete motor shutdown.

MAINTENANCE TIPS

Maintenance Tips for Westchester Properties

πŸ› οΈ Regular Gearbox Lubrication
Crucial for Ramset's heavy-duty performance, ensure your motor's gearbox is regularly lubricated following manufacturer guidelines to minimize friction and prevent premature wear on internal gears, especially vital given constant use in Westchester.
πŸ› οΈ Check for Overheating
After multiple gate cycles, routinely check the motor housing for excessive heat. Abnormal warmth often points to deeper issues like failing components, warranting prompt professional inspection to prevent damage in Westchester's hot environment.
πŸ› οΈ Keep Motor Enclosure Sealed
Regularly inspect the motor's protective casing for any breaches or compromised seals, particularly following Westchester's heavy rains. This prevents moisture from infiltrating and damaging sensitive internal electrical components, a common threat in Florida's humid climate.

Ramset Gate Motor Repair FAQ β€” Westchester, FL

Q: My Ramset gate motor makes a loud grinding noise. What could be causing it?+
A: Grinding noises from a Ramset motor usually point to issues within the gearbox, such as worn gears, bearings, or a lack of proper lubrication. It could also be debris interfering with the moving parts. Professional inspection is crucial to prevent further damage.
Q: Is it possible to repair a Ramset gate motor, or will I need a full replacement?+
A: In many cases, Ramset gate motors can be repaired by replacing specific components like bearings, capacitors, or even rewinding the motor. Our technicians always assess the extent of the damage to determine the most cost-effective and reliable solution for you.
Q: How does Westchester's climate affect Ramset gate motors?+
A: Westchester's high humidity and heavy rainfall can lead to corrosion inside the motor housing, impacting electrical connections and mechanical parts. Proper sealing and regular maintenance are vital to combat these environmental factors and extend motor life.
Q: My Ramset gate motor hums but doesn't move the gate. What does this mean?+
A: A humming motor typically indicates that power is reaching the motor, but a mechanical impediment or internal motor failure (like a seized bearing or failed capacitor) is preventing rotation. This requires immediate professional attention to avoid motor burnout.
Q: What are the typical lifespans for Ramset gate motors, and how can I extend it?+
A: Ramset motors are built to last, often exceeding 10-15 years with proper care. Regular preventative maintenance, including lubrication and inspection by a professional, is key to maximizing its lifespan, especially in Florida's challenging conditions.
